Company Overview
History and Background
Tradeweb Markets Inc. was founded in 1996 by a consortium of major financial institutions to create a more efficient electronic trading platform for fixed income securities. It quickly became a leader in the institutional fixed income, derivatives, and ETF markets. Key milestones include its initial public offering (IPO) in April 2019, which significantly increased its visibility and access to capital. Over the years, Tradeweb has expanded its offerings and geographical reach, adapting to evolving market structures and technological advancements.
Core Business Areas
- Fixed Income: Tradeweb operates a leading electronic marketplace for government bonds, corporate bonds, mortgage-backed securities, and other fixed income instruments. This segment facilitates trading for institutional investors and dealers, offering pre-trade analytics, execution tools, and post-trade processing.
- Derivatives: The company provides electronic trading solutions for a wide range of derivatives, including interest rate swaps, credit default swaps, and equity derivatives. This allows for more efficient execution and straight-through processing in complex over-the-counter (OTC) markets.
- Exchange-Traded Funds (ETFs): Tradeweb offers a comprehensive ETF marketplace for institutional investors to trade ETFs across various asset classes. This includes access to liquidity providers and tools for portfolio management and risk assessment.
- Money Markets: This segment facilitates electronic trading of short-term debt instruments, such as commercial paper and certificates of deposit, providing efficient access to funding and investment opportunities.

Top Products and Market Share
Key Offerings
- Product Name 1: US Treasury Trading Platform. This platform is a leading electronic venue for trading US Treasury securities, offering significant liquidity and efficient execution for institutional investors. Competitors include direct dealer-to-client platforms, other interdealer brokers, and electronic communication networks (ECNs) that offer Treasury trading capabilities.
- Product Name 2: Interest Rate Swap (IRS) Trading Platform. Tradeweb is a dominant player in the IRS market, providing electronic access to a broad range of swap products for hedging and speculation. Key competitors include CME Group, Bloomberg, and other financial technology providers offering similar derivatives trading solutions.
- Product Name 3: Corporate Bond Trading Platform. The platform facilitates the trading of corporate bonds, providing buy-side and sell-side firms with efficient price discovery and execution. Competitors include MarketAxess, Fidelity Investments' fixed income trading desk, and various broker-dealer proprietary platforms.
- Product Name 4: ETF Trading Platform. Tradeweb offers a robust platform for institutional ETF trading, connecting liquidity providers and asset managers. Major competitors in this space include platforms like Virtu Financial, Jane Street, and the trading desks of large investment banks.

Competitive Landscape
Tradeweb's advantages lie in its strong liquidity networks, deep client relationships, and broad product coverage in fixed income and derivatives. Competitors like MarketAxess excel in corporate bond trading, while CME and ICE dominate futures and options markets. Bloomberg offers a comprehensive terminal with trading capabilities across various asset classes. Virtu Financial is a leading market maker and technology provider. Tradeweb's strategic focus on institutional electronic trading provides a solid foundation, but it must continually innovate to maintain its edge against these diversified competitors.

Tradeweb Markets Inc., together with its subsidiaries, builds and operates electronic marketplaces worldwide. The company's marketplaces facilitate trading in a range of asset classes, including rates, credit, money markets, and equities. It offers pre-trade data and analytics, trade execution, and trade processing, as well as post-trade data, analytics, and reporting services. The company provides flexible order and trading systems to institutional investors. It also offers a range of electronic, voice, and hybrid platforms to dealers and financial institutions on electronic or hybrid markets with Dealerweb platform; and trading solutions for financial advisory firms and traders with Tradeweb Direct platform. The company serves in the institutional, wholesale, and retail client sectors. Its customers include asset managers, hedge funds, insurance companies, central banks, banks and dealers, proprietary trading firms, retail brokerage and financial advisory firms, and regional dealers. The company was founded in 1996 and is headquartered in New York, New York. Tradeweb Markets Inc. operates as a subsidiary of Refinitiv Parent Limited.
